C bankamatik örnegi
#include <stdio.h>
#include <conio.h>
int tutar;
void bankamatik(int miktar)
{
int a,ikiyuz,elli,bes,on,yirmi,yuz;
a=miktar;
if(a%5==0) //5'e tam bölünmeli
{
ikiyuz=a/200;
a-=ikiyuz*100;
yuz=a/100;
a-=yuz*100;
elli=a/50;
a-=elli*50;
yirmi=a/20;
a-=yirmi*20;
on=a/10;
a-=on*10;
bes=a/5;
a-=bes*5;
printf("\nikiyuzluluk :%d",ikiyuz);
printf("\nyuzluk:%d",yuz);
printf("\n ellilik :%d",elli);
printf("\n yirmilik: %d",yirmi);
printf("\n onluk:%d",on);
printf("\n beslik:%d",bes);
}
else
printf("lutfen 5 ve 5in katlarını giriniz.");
}
main()
{
printf("Cekilecek para miktari (YTL) = ");
scanf("%d",&tutar);
bankamatik(tutar); //kullanıcıdan girilen tutarı bankamatik işlemine alır.
}
#include <conio.h>
int tutar;
void bankamatik(int miktar)
{
int a,ikiyuz,elli,bes,on,yirmi,yuz;
a=miktar;
if(a%5==0) //5'e tam bölünmeli
{
ikiyuz=a/200;
a-=ikiyuz*100;
yuz=a/100;
a-=yuz*100;
elli=a/50;
a-=elli*50;
yirmi=a/20;
a-=yirmi*20;
on=a/10;
a-=on*10;
bes=a/5;
a-=bes*5;
printf("\nikiyuzluluk :%d",ikiyuz);
printf("\nyuzluk:%d",yuz);
printf("\n ellilik :%d",elli);
printf("\n yirmilik: %d",yirmi);
printf("\n onluk:%d",on);
printf("\n beslik:%d",bes);
}
else
printf("lutfen 5 ve 5in katlarını giriniz.");
}
main()
{
printf("Cekilecek para miktari (YTL) = ");
scanf("%d",&tutar);
bankamatik(tutar); //kullanıcıdan girilen tutarı bankamatik işlemine alır.
}
![]() |
| bankamatik |

Yorumlar
Yorum Gönder